Ty DavisTy Davis
I came today to see what all the rage was about in the community. Decor - It reminds you of a Chip/Joanna Gaines-styled interior, ie southern chic/industrial. They’ve got a great selection of coffee and drinks, but it appears food is limited to appetizer-sized portions. This was expected, to me, but just in case a person is expecting Panera-styled options, this is not that. Coffee - I went plain today, decaf and hemp milk. I was expecting to see coconut milk and almond milk as alternatives, and was surprised to see the milk alternatives were hemp and soy. I have never seen a coffee joint offer hemp milk as your milk alternative. I didn’t know this, but they do serve alcohol. I don’t know how, ie mixed drinks, a shot in your coffee, etc., but I saw a Tito’s sign and asked and one employee confirmed they sell alcohol.

avatar
5.0
7y

I’m always a little hesitant to try a new place with my daughter. She has a severe peanut, treenut, and egg allergy, and it makes trying new places hard. The staff went above and beyond to make sure she could eat and be safe. They checked all of the ingredients and even went as far as going to the back to get a dressert for her that had yet to be put in the display (the display has items that have nuts, therefore she can’t have those items in case there is a cross contamination). It is very rare that a restaurant shows any concern for her needs, and even more rare to find a place that showed as much true concern as they did. The food was delicious (I had the chicken salad on a gluten free bun) and the coffee was amazing. If you haven’t tried it out, please do so.
